Grant Thornton is seeking experienced Business Analysts to join our Consulting team. The role offers a chance to contribute to and support a variety of client engagements helping drive project team success within the project management and change and innovation space. This is a fast-paced high-growth environment offering the opportunity to build on existing skills while working alongside talented professionals.
The role will focus on delivering consulting services in finance transformation operational excellence project and change management strategy digital and business transformation with a particular emphasis on core Business Analyst responsibilities in the banking and financial services domain.

Roles & Responsibilities
- Map and redesign processes by capturing as-is vs. to-be workflows and identifying improvement opportunities.
- Elicit analyse and document business requirements through workshops stakeholder interviews and Business Requirements Documents (BRDs).
- Develop business cases quantifying return on investment cost savings and efficiency impacts.
- Conduct Business Impact Assessments and maintain a Requirements Traceability Matrix.
- Review project requirements with client stakeholders (internal and external 3rd parties) and liaise with technical teams to perform gap analyses and impact assessments.
- Ensure traceability between user requirements functional specifications and testing deliverables.
- Support governance activities by running steering meetings capturing decisions and aligning on scope.
- Ensure solutions meet agreed specifications comply with security and regulatory requirements and are fit for purpose.
- Contribute to agile delivery approaches (e.g. daily scrums backlog refinement).
- Experience in mapping end-to-end customer journeys for retail banking products such as personal loans mortgages and credit cards.
- Perform basic project management tasks and status reporting supporting delivery teams.
- Third party and vendor management to support project delivery.
Skills and Experience
Education and Certifications
- Honours degree in IT Engineering Business or equivalent discipline.
- Min 3 - 8 years relevant experience as a Business Analyst.
- Previous experience in IT systems implementation projects.
- Ideally qualified in ECBA / CCBA / CBAP.
Skills and Competencies
- Financial Services Industry experience including Retail Banking Asset Management and Insurance.
- Familiarity with Central Bank of Ireland Regulatory Landscape including the Consumer Protection Code.
- Strong documentation and communication skills with the ability to produce structured comprehensive outputs.
- Strong analytical and interpersonal skills with a commitment to professional and client service excellence and developing effective working relationships.
- Expertise in C-Suite / Senior Management engagement and communication.
- Strong multi-tasking abilities and the ability to meet deadlines in a dynamic environment.
- Demonstrated drive commitment and enthusiasm for professional growth.
- Analytical mindset with a focus on delivering measurable business outcomes.
